Jury Declines to Indict Rumson Parent Charged in RBR Baseball Brawl

A grand jury did not indict a Rumson man who faced a simple assault charge after a brawl at a Rumson-Fair Haven Regional High School (RFH) versus Red Bank Regional (RBR) baseball game, according to a story on app.com.

The charges stem from a bench-clearing incident at the end of the RBR home game's sixth inning when Patrick Maisto, the Rumson parent, allegedly attacked a player, the report said.
 
Maisto's attorney, Mitchell Ansell, of Ansell, Grimm & Aaron, Ocean Township, told the Asbury Park Press that Maisto hired an investigator who ended up getting him exonerated.

However, as a result of the incident, both teams were disqualified for the NJSIAA Tournament.
